Output 25432f368695c95339088e159921a71930c52960034095a433a8486860f79e19:0

value
379821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 131c1ddd10f6c56234e7fae9d84d296f97c892c0 OP_EQUAL
address
33S4SmVaMnTnsQh82dsDsSfAANcPWnaywW
transaction
25432f368695c95339088e159921a71930c52960034095a433a8486860f79e19
spent
true